引言
随着信息技术的飞速发展,大数据已经成为各个行业变革的重要驱动力。对于初学者而言,大数据的世界充满了未知和挑战。本文将为您揭秘大数据的入门攻略与实战技巧,帮助您轻松掌握数据分析的奥秘。
一、大数据概述
1.1 什么是大数据?
大数据(Big Data)指的是规模巨大、类型多样的数据集,无法用常规软件工具进行捕捉、管理和处理的数据。它具有以下四个V特征:
- Volume(体量):数据量庞大,通常超过传统数据库的处理能力。
- Velocity(速度):数据产生速度快,需要实时或接近实时的处理和分析。
- Variety(多样性):数据类型多样,包括结构化、半结构化和非结构化数据。
- Value(价值):数据蕴含着巨大的价值,需要通过分析和挖掘来发现。
1.2 大数据的应用领域
大数据在各个领域都有广泛的应用,如:
- 金融行业:风险评估、欺诈检测、个性化推荐等。
- 医疗健康:疾病预测、患者管理、药物研发等。
- 交通出行:智能交通、交通流量预测、公共交通优化等。
- 零售电商:需求预测、客户画像、精准营销等。
二、大数据入门攻略
2.1 学习基础知识
- 编程语言:掌握至少一门编程语言,如Python、Java等,熟悉基本语法和数据结构。
- 数据库:了解关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)。
- 数据挖掘:学习数据挖掘的基本概念、方法和工具,如Python的pandas、scikit-learn等。
2.2 熟悉大数据技术栈
- Hadoop:了解Hadoop生态系统,包括HDFS、MapReduce、YARN等。
- Spark:掌握Spark的核心概念和API,熟悉Spark SQL、Spark Streaming等。
- 数据可视化:学习数据可视化工具,如Tableau、Power BI等。
2.3 实践项目
- 数据清洗:处理缺失值、异常值等。
- 数据预处理:将数据转换为适合分析的格式。
- 数据分析:使用统计、机器学习等方法挖掘数据价值。
三、实战技巧
3.1 数据处理
- Hadoop生态系统:利用HDFS存储海量数据,使用MapReduce进行分布式计算。
- Spark:高效处理大规模数据集,支持实时计算和流处理。
3.2 数据分析
- 统计方法:使用描述性统计、推断性统计等方法分析数据。
- 机器学习:掌握常用的机器学习算法,如线性回归、决策树、支持向量机等。
- 深度学习:学习神经网络、卷积神经网络等深度学习模型。
3.3 数据可视化
- 工具选择:根据需求选择合适的数据可视化工具。
- 图表设计:设计直观、美观的图表,展示数据特征和趋势。
四、总结
大数据时代,数据分析已成为一项重要的技能。通过学习本文所介绍的内容,您将能够掌握大数据的入门知识和实战技巧,为您的职业生涯增添一份竞争力。祝您在数据分析的道路上越走越远!
